Alpather Lake

Location

13 km from Gulmarg, lies the Alpather Lake at the foot of the Apharwat peaks. The lake is covered with snow throughout the year. It is frozen until June and even later one can see lumps of ice floating in the lake. The lake and the nearby area is an ideal place for trekking.

There are several other places near Gulmarg that simply prove to be tourists' delights. The outer circular walk in Gulmarg is a wonderful way to have a glimpse of the Nanga Parbat, Harmukh, the rugged slopes of Ferozepur, Sunset Peak and the Apharwat Ridge.

Khilanmarg

Location

This beautiful valley is the most picturesque place filled with countless flowers near Gulmarg. Located 6 km from Gulmarg, Khilanmarg offers a breathtaking view of the majestic peaks with their reflections in Wular and other lakes. Spring is the best season to walk through this valley.

Durgapur Barrage

Location

Durgapur Barrage is definitely one of the best places to see the effort of people to contain nature’s fury. To say in few words, Durgapur Barrage is a real embodiment of human effort. One can see a phenomenal sight of water letting out from the lock-gates of barrage. The canal is a few yards away from the main barrage. There is a short foot bridge over it. One can try to cross over it, a wonderful experience. Enjoy the beauty and cool breeze in the beach.

Frazerganj

Location

Fraserganj has a beautiful beach and is only 2 kms away from Bakkhali. The white sand beach, is entirely different from the other beaches. It is pristine pure and holds the charms of a beach unspoilt. It can be accessed from Kolkata, and is a three hours drive on very good roads. The destination is also all too famous for the migratory birds that can be sighted over there.

Tiger Hill

Location

The Tiger Hill is located about 11 km from Darjeeling, at an altitude of 2555 meters above the sea level. The dawn view of Kanchenjunga, the highest mount after Mount Everest and K2, and other eastern peaks of the Himalayas is excellent.

On a clear day, Mount Everest, which is around 225 km from Tiger Hills, can also be seen; however, this is a rare sight. One must get up at 4 am to be able to be there to watch the sunrise. As the sun rises, the color of the mountain changes, which is an amazing sight.
